大语言模型(LLMs)在文学创作领域的快速发展,引发了创意真实性与伦理问题,使检测AI生成文本变得迫切。现有方法主要针对现代汉语,尚未覆盖古典中文诗歌。由于古典诗歌具有严格的格律、共用意象体系及灵活语法,判断其是否由AI生成极具挑战。为此,我们提出ChangAn基准,包含总计30,664首诗歌,其中10,276首为人工创作,20,388首由四款主流大模型生成。基于此,我们系统评估了12种AI检测器在不同文本粒度和生成策略下的表现。结果表明,现有中文文本检测工具在古典诗歌场景下普遍失效,准确率不足60%。该研究验证了ChangAn的有效性与必要性。数据集与代码已开源:https://github.com/VelikayaScarlet/ChangAn。

原文摘要 · Abstract (English)

The rapid development of large language models (LLMs) has extended text generation tasks into the literary domain. However, AI-generated literary creations has raised increasingly prominent issues of creative authenticity and ethics in literary world, making the detection of LLM-generated literary texts essential and urgent. While previous works have made significant progress in detecting AI-generated text, it has yet to address classical Chinese poetry. Due to the unique linguistic features of classical Chinese poetry, such as strict metrical regularity, a shared system of poetic imagery, and flexible syntax, distinguishing whether a poem is authored by AI presents a substantial challenge. To address these issues, we introduce ChangAn, a benchmark for detecting LLM-generated classical Chinese poetry that containing total 30,664 poems, 10,276 are human-written poems and 20,388 poems are generated by four popular LLMs. Based on ChangAn, we conducted a systematic evaluation of 12 AI detectors, investigating their performance variations across different text granularities and generation strategies. Our findings highlight the limitations of current Chinese text detectors, which fail to serve as reliable tools for detecting LLM-generated classical Chinese poetry. These results validate the effectiveness and necessity of our proposed ChangAn benchmark. Our dataset and code are available at https://github.com/VelikayaScarlet/ChangAn.
